WINTER WORKSHOP

DIAGNOSING AND TREATING ADHD and DEFINING AND ADDRESSING EDUCATIONAL NEEDS OF STUDENTS WITH ADHD IN HIGHER EDUCATION
March 16, 2012
9 am until 4:30 pm
Princeton, WV
6 CEU's approved for LPC's
Presented by Sylvia Wright, EdD, EdS, MEd, LPC, ALPS

Morning session will include diagnosis and assessment in children, biological causes, strategies for counselors to address with parents and teachers
Afternoon will include adults with ADHD, behaviors and issues that impact in higher education, community services, academic and work strategies
